BLESSING OF THE ANIMALS AND BAKE SALE Saturday October 7 10:00AM-1:00PM
In honor of the Feast of St. Francis, St. Mark’s is holding its annual Blessing of the Animals and Bake Sale on Saturday October 7, 2023 from 10:00 a.m. – 1:00 p.m. in the church courtyard. Rain or shine. Everyone is invited to bring their beloved pet of any species for a special personalized blessing by St. Mark’s priest The Reverend Nancy L. Threadgill. Please keep dogs on leashes and other pets gently restrained as appropriate for their species.
Assorted baked goods and other edible items will be available for sale.
A Prayer for Animals and Those Who Care for Them
Dear God, You have given us care over all living things; protect and bless the animals who give us companionship and delight and make us their true friends and worthy companions. Amen.

ST. MARK’S DISCERNMENT PROCESS
Our Priest-in-Charge, The Reverend Nancy L. Threadgill will be retiring soon. We and St. Francis-in-the-Fields in Somerset, PA will share a new priest. We have begun the discernment process that ultimately will lead to our calling our new priest. Monthly updates on our progress are available in our newsletter, The Grapevine, found under the main menu tab “About.” Now and throughout the process, we ask that you join us in praying the following prayer for guidance.
Gracious and loving God, you know us better than we know ourselves. Guide the Discernment Committees, Vestries, and people of St. Francis-in-the Fields and St. Mark’s through this time of transition and discernment. We pray that your Holy Spirit continues to open our hearts and minds to new opportunities and ideas; so that we may follow where you lead — knowing that Jesus Christ walks with us each step of the way.
Empower each and every member of the Discernment Committees to use their gifts for ministry to the fullest; to share their thoughts openly and honestly; to respect the opinions of others; and to encourage humility, patience, and joy.
Finally, instill in all the people of St. Mark’s and St. Francis in-the-Fields a glorious vision of the future; that, guided by your Holy Spirit, we may be united in love — with warm hearts, enlightened minds and open arms — so that we may gladly accomplish the mission to which you are calling us; through Jesus Christ our Lord. Amen.
Adapted from Rector Search Committee Prayer, Christ Church, Winnetka, IL
